Tinker Tailor Soldier Spy (2011)
Description: A slow-burning, atmospheric spy thriller that focuses on betrayal, loyalty, and the psychological toll of espionage.
Fact: The film is based on John le Carré's novel of the same name, and the author himself was a former British intelligence officer.


Homeland (2011)
Description: A high-stakes espionage series that explores themes of paranoia, mental health, and the moral ambiguities of intelligence work.
Fact: The show was initially inspired by an Israeli series called 'Prisoners of War.'


The Americans (2013)
Description: A gripping spy drama that delves deep into the personal and professional lives of undercover agents, blending intense action with emotional family dynamics.
Fact: The show was praised for its historical accuracy, often incorporating real-life Cold War events into its storyline.


The Bureau (2015)
Description: A realistic portrayal of the daily lives of intelligence officers, focusing on the bureaucratic and emotional challenges they face.
Fact: The series is known for its meticulous attention to detail, with many scenes inspired by real-life espionage cases.


Deutschland 83 (2015)
Description: A Cold War-era drama that follows a young East German spy sent to the West, capturing the tension and paranoia of the time.
Fact: The show was the first German-language series to air on a U.S. network, SundanceTV.


Berlin Station (2016)
Description: A modern spy series that combines political intrigue with personal drama, set against the backdrop of contemporary Berlin.
Fact: The show was filmed on location in Berlin, adding authenticity to its depiction of the city's espionage underworld.


Condor (2018)
Description: A tense thriller that follows a young analyst who uncovers a conspiracy, forcing him to go on the run while using his skills to survive.
Fact: The show is based on the 1975 novel 'Six Days of the Condor' and its subsequent film adaptation.


The Spy (2019)
Description: A biographical drama that portrays the life of a real-life spy, highlighting the personal sacrifices and emotional struggles of living a double life.
Fact: The series is based on the true story of Eli Cohen, one of Israel's most famous spies.


The Night Manager (2016)
Description: A stylish and suspenseful adaptation of a John le Carré novel, featuring a hotel manager drawn into the world of international arms dealing.
Fact: The series won several awards, including Golden Globes for its lead actor and supporting actor.


Counterpart (2017)
Description: A unique blend of spy thriller and science fiction, exploring parallel worlds and the duality of human nature.
Fact: The series was praised for its intricate plot and the dual performance of its lead actor, who played two versions of the same character.
